1894 – Donaldson Hotel, Fargo, North Dakota, USA

Built as a meetingplace for the local branch of the International Order of Odd Fellows, an offshoot of the Masons. The building has a fine sandstone facade with an excellent Palladian window over the main entrance way. The building is now an hotel and bar.
